如何获取C1N短网址 API开放平台密钥分步指南
在当今的数字化时代,短网址服务因其能够有效缩短长链接、提升用户体验并便于分享,在数字媒体、社交媒体营销及软件开发中扮演着至关重要的角色。C1N短网址API开放平台凭借其高效、稳定的服务,成为了众多开发者和企业首选的工具之一。为了充分利用C1N短网址API的各项功能,获取API密钥是首要且关键的一步。本文将详细指导你如何逐步获取C1N短网址API开放平台的密钥,帮助你顺利开启短网址生成与管理的便捷之旅,同时概述在使用过程中可能需要注意的几个重要环节。
1. 创建或登录到C1N短网址 API开放平台
2. 获取token
登入以后进入我的信息页面复制token
3. 代码接入
接口地址:https://c1n.cn/link/short
请求方式:POST
请求头:Headers
参数名 | 是否必须 | 说明 |
---|---|---|
token | 是 | 请前往「控制台」-「我的信息」获取token |
请求参数:Form 表单
参数名 | 是否必须 | 说明 |
---|---|---|
url | 是 | 原始网址,以http://或https://开头 |
key | 否 | 自定义短链后缀,不填则随机生成5位 |
remark | 否 | 短链标题 |
expiryDate | 否 | 有效期,例如:2023-10-20 00:00:00,默认永久有效 |
domainName | 否 | 指定自有域名(需要先在控制台绑定域名) |
请求示例
function shortUrl(longUrl) {
var xhr = new XMLHttpRequest();
var url = 'https://c1n.cn/link/short';
var headers = {
'Content-Type': 'application/x-www-form-urlencoded',
'token': 'your_token' // 替换为您的token
};
var data = 'url=' + encodeURIComponent(longUrl) + '&key=&remark=&expiryDate=';
xhr.open('POST', url, true);
for (var key in headers) {
xhr.setRequestHeader(key, headers[key]);
}
xhr.onreadystatechange = function() {
if (xhr.readyState === XMLHttpRequest.DONE) {
if (xhr.status === 200) {
var responseJson = JSON.parse(xhr.responseText);
if (responseJson.code === 0) {
console.log(responseJson.data);
} else {
console.log(responseJson.msg);
}
} else {
console.log('Error:', xhr.status);
}
}
};
xhr.send(data);
}
shortUrl('https://example.com'); // 替换为您要生成短链接的原始网址
响应数据:JSON
{
code: 0,
data: "https://c1n.cn/xxxxx",
msg: "成功"
}
说明:code为0表示成功,其他情况表示生成失败。
4. 常见问题
Q:如何找到C1N短网址API开放平台
A:幂简集成是国内领先的API集成管理平台,专注于为开发者提供全面、高效、易用的API集成解决方案。幂简API平台可以通过以下两种方式找到所需API:通过关键词搜索API(例如,输入’C1N短网址API开放平台‘这类品类词,更容易找到结果)、或者从API hub分类页进入寻找。
Q:如何注册并获取C1N短网址API的token?
A:您需要在C1N短网址的官方网站上注册一个账户,完成注册后,系统将会为您生成一个唯一的API token。这个token将用于验证您的请求,请妥善保管。
Q:我如何发送API请求来生成短链接?
A:您可以使用您熟悉的编程语言或工具,向C1N短网址的API接口发送请求。在请求中,您需要包含要缩短的原始链接以及您的API token。API接口将返回生成的短链接。
Q:我如何管理已经生成的短链接?
A:通过C1N短网址API,您可以对已经生成的短链接进行编辑、删除、暂停等操作。具体方法请参考API文档中的相关说明。
Q:如何在一次请求中翻译多个单词或者多段文本?
A:您可以在发送的字段【src_text】中用换行符(在多数编程语言中为转义符号 )来分隔要翻译的多个单词或者多段文本,这样即可得到多个独立的翻译结果。注意在发送请求前需对【src_text】字段做URL encode!
除了C1N短网址API开放平台,还有其他替代服务商也提供类似api服务,例如:
short-link API开放平台、یون | yun.ir API开放平台、TinyURL API开放平台
更多竞品可以在幂简集成开放平台中找到。
Q:C1N短网址API开放平台这个密钥还适用于哪些api?
5. 总结
本文全面且详细地阐述了获取C1N短网址API开放平台密钥的完整流程,为开发者们打造了一份条理清晰、操作简便的分步指南。从平台账号的注册起始,历经开发者身份的严格认证,直至最终成功获取API密钥,每一步操作均辅以详尽的说明与指导,确保开发者们能够轻松驾驭整个流程,无惧任何技术难关。本文还特别强调了进行可用性测试的重要性,这是确保C1N短网址API能够无缝集成至应用中,并充分发挥其缩短链接、优化分享体验等强大功能的关键一环。通过测试,开发者们可以全面验证API的集成效果,确保其在实际应用中能够稳定、高效地运行。本文为开发者们提供了一个全面、详尽且极具实用价值的操作指南,不仅助力他们顺利获取了C1N短网址API开放平台的密钥,还为他们如何高效地将这一强大的短网址服务集成至应用中提供了宝贵的建议。我们坚信,随着开发者们对这一指南的深入学习与实践,C1N短网址API将成为他们提升应用性能、优化用户体验的得力助手。